65 Individuals Graduate from American University of Peace Studies

A total of 65 individuals, including 30 members of the Guyana Police Force, recently graduated from the American University of Peace Studies (AUPS). The graduating class comprises individuals who have completed programs in Forensic, General, and Clinical psychology, earning Diplomas, Degrees, and Master’s qualifications. Medical Laboratory Technician Program Launched in Region Six

The Ministry of Health, in collaboration with the Health Sciences Division, has initiated a Medical Laboratory Technician (MLT) program in Region Six, training twenty-five individuals to become skilled professionals in the field. New Health Centre Commissioned at Schepmoed, East Bank of Berbice

The Ministry of Health has officially commissioned a new health centre at Schepmoed on the East Bank of Berbice, representing a significant addition to primary healthcare services in Region Six. Government Technical Institute (GTI) Marks 72nd Graduation Ceremony with 398 Graduates

The Government Technical Institute (GTI) recently celebrated its 72nd graduation exercise and prize-giving ceremony at the National Culture Center in Georgetown. The event honored a total of 398 students who received certificates across various disciplines, including Business, Electrical, and Computer Science.
